Thorn Baker Construction is looking for a skilled labourer to support Stone Masons on a large country house located near Glastonbury, Somerset. The role requires a full valid CSCS card and offers free on-site parking.

Responsibilities

  • Loading out stone
  • Mixing muck
  • Assisting stone masons
  • Raking out
  • Ensuring the site is safe to work and clearing walkways
  • General labouring

Qualifications & Requirements

  • Full valid CSCS card
  • Face fit certificate
  • Two relevant references
  • Can do attitude with a strong work ethic
